The advent of compact OLED displays has spurred interest in their integration with the Raspberry Pi 4 platform, promising dynamic visual feedback in a multitude of applications. The Raspberry Pi 4, distinguished for its computational power, harmonizes effortlessly with high-resolution OLED display technology, establishing a formidable foundation for real-time data presentation, status monitoring, and interactive user interfaces. This study offers guidance on the hardware setup, software configuration, and code implementation for researchers, developers, and enthusiasts. Through systematic experimentation and detailed analysis, this research showcases the effectiveness and promise of this integration, endowing users with intuitive data comprehension and interactive engagement. Furthermore, the paper examines the far-reaching implications and potential applications of this integration, encompassing diverse domains like Internet of Things (IoT) deployments.
